A Postgraduate Certificate in Data Protection for Software Developers equips you with the in-depth knowledge and practical skills needed to navigate the complex landscape of data privacy regulations. This specialized program focuses on integrating data protection principles directly into the software development lifecycle.
Learning outcomes include a comprehensive understanding of GDPR, CCPA, and other relevant legislation. You will master techniques for building privacy-by-design into applications, handling personal data securely, and conducting data protection impact assessments (DPIAs). The program also covers data security best practices and incident response procedures.
The duration of the Postgraduate Certificate typically ranges from a few months to a year, depending on the program's intensity and structure. Many programs offer flexible learning options, accommodating busy professionals.

A Postgraduate Certificate in Data Protection is increasingly significant for software developers in the UK. The UK's burgeoning data economy, coupled with stringent regulations like the GDPR, demands professionals with specialist knowledge. The Information Commissioner's Office (ICO) reported a 40% rise in data breach notifications in 2022, highlighting the critical need for robust data protection practices within software development. This necessitates a deep understanding of data privacy principles and their practical application in coding and software design.
This specialized qualification equips developers with the expertise to build compliant software, mitigating the risk of costly fines and reputational damage. The certificate covers key areas, including data governance, encryption techniques, privacy-enhancing technologies, and legal frameworks – all crucial for software developers navigating the complex landscape of UK data protection laws.
